Step-by-step: appointment through Android settings

The basic method of prioritizing is hidden in the deep layers of the operating system's settings menu. The interface may vary slightly depending on the Android version (11, 12, 13 or 14) and the shell version, but the logic remains the same. First, open the main menu and find the gear icon.

In the menu that opens, select the Apps section. In some firmware versions, it may be called All Apps or Application Management. It stores the full list of installed software. Find Yandex (or Yandex) in the list and click on it to go to the details.

Inside the application card, scroll down to Additional or immediately look for the default Start line. When you click on it, you'll see a switch or a default Use button. Activate this element. The system can request confirmation of an action or alert you to a change in device behavior, agree.

MIUI/HyperOS versionThe path to adjustmentFeatures of the menu
MIUI 12 / 13Applications β†’ Application Management β†’ Yandex β†’ Default LaunchClassic Android Menu
MIUI 14Settings β†’ Applications β†’ All applications β†’ Yandex β†’ AdditionalAdded nesting level
HyperOS 1.0Settings β†’ Applications β†’ Application Management β†’ Three Points β†’ Special. accessChanged access structure
Android 13+Settings β†’ Applications β†’ Applications by defaultGlobal system setup

After activating the switch, the system will stop asking what to open the link, and will automatically use the selected option. If the "Start by default" option is not available or it is inactive, try running any link from the messenger - the system will prompt you to choose the priority application.

There is a faster, more popular way to prioritize, which often works better than manually digging through menus, and for that, look for a text hyperlink in any messenger (Telegram, WhatsApp, Viber) or in your notes, which can be a news site or video hosting address.

Click on the link. If you have multiple browsers installed, Android will pop up asking "What to open?" In this window, you will see the icons of the available applications. Select Yandex Browser. Below or next to the icon will be a checkbox or button Always (or Always).

The good thing about this method is that it tests the functionality of the setup immediately, and if you click on the link, it means that the priority is successfully established, and in the future all HTTP and HTTPS requests will be processed by this software without further questions.

⚠️ Note: If you click on a link, the selection window does not appear, but the system browser opens immediately, then it has already been given a strict priority. In this case, you must first reset the settings of the old browser, as described in the first section.

Sometimes the system may "forget" the choice after rebooting or updating the components of Google Play Services. If you notice that links are again opened in the wrong place, just repeat the procedure of calling the selection window.

Typical Problems and Conflicts

Xiaomi users may experience a situation where the system ignores the choice or constantly returns the Mi Browser as the main one, often due to the peculiarities of the MIUI shell, which seeks to return the user to its ecosystem, in which cases, cleaning the cache of the Android System WebView service helps.

To do this, go to Settings β†’ Apps β†’ All apps. Find the Android System WebView (could be called "Web Content Component"). Click Clear β†’ Clear Everything. This action will reset all temporary link associations, and the next time the system starts, the system will ask again about preferences.

  • πŸ”„ Forced stop of the system browser before setting up a new one.
  • πŸ“² Update Google Play Services to the latest version via the Store.
  • πŸ” Check for hidden profiles or modes of "Guest", where the settings could have gone wrong.

Another common problem is version conflict: If you have a beta version of your browser or a modified build installed, Xiaomi’s security system may block its main purpose, in which case it is recommended to remove the current version and download the official build from a reliable source.

Why is Mi Browser coming back on its own?
The MIUI shell has a hidden system application recovery mechanism. If you delete the Mi Browser completely (via ADB), the system can return it when you update the firmware and assign it to the main one. Solution: after each major update, check the settings again.

What to do if after updating the firmware settings are lost?
When you update MIUI or HyperOS, system files are overwritten, which can return the factory settings of the applications. You will have to re-assign the main browser. To avoid data loss, make sure that the browser itself is enabled to sync with the cloud before upgrading the system.
Can I completely remove the Mi Browser system?
It can't be removed by standard means, it can only be disabled. ADB-commands, but this is not recommended for ordinary users, as it can disrupt the work of some system news widgets.
Does changing your browser affect your phone’s speed?
There is no direct impact on overall OS speed, but a more streamlined page rendering engine can make browsing the web much smoother. Heavy system browsers often consume more RAM, which on budget Xiaomi models can cause interface slowdowns.
